Baseball Recap: Pensacola Tigers vs. West Florida Baptist Academy Conquerors
Pensacola had to endure a five-game losing streak, but that streak is no more. They put the hurt on the West Florida Baptist Academy Conquerors with a sharp 12-2 win on Thursday. Pensacola's offense finally found a way to get into gear: the high-octane performance was a 180-degree turn from their last three games.
JULIO GUZMAN made a big impact no matter where he played. On the mound, he struck out 14 batters over five innings while giving up just two earned runs off three hits. GUZMAN has been nothing but reliable: he hasn't tossed less than five strikeouts in six consecutive pitching appearances. GUZMAN was also big at the plate, scoring two runs and stealing four bases while going 2-for-2.
In other batting news, CAMERON HAMILTON was a standout: he scored two runs and stole five bases while getting on base in all three of his plate appearances. BRAYLEN STEELE was another key contributor, going 2-for-2 with two runs, a triple, and a stolen base.
On West Florida Baptist Academy's side, Ethan Salter was cooking despite his team's loss, scoring two runs and stealing two bases while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ances. Another player making a difference was Alan McAlarney, who went 2-for-3 with two stolen bases and an RBI.
Pensacola's victory bumped their record up to 4-12. As for West Florida Baptist Academy, they have not been sharp recently as the team has lost five of their last six games, which put a noticeable dent in their 3-7 record this season.
Pensacola will head out on the road to face off against LeFlore at 6:00 p.m. on Friday. LeFlore hasn't scored more than two runs for four games straight, a trend the team is eager to reverse. As for West Florida Baptist Academy, they did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next contest, a 3-2 loss vs. Trinitas Christian on the 4th.
